Product description
Phosphoenolpyruvate (PEP) and HCO3- react under the action of phosphoenolpyruvate carboxykinase and Mg2+ to form oxaloacetate and phosphate. Oxaloacetate reacts with malate dehydrogenase to form malate, oxidizing NADH to NAD+. The rate of NADH consumption is proportional to the CO2 content in the sample. By measuring the change in absorbance at 340nm, the CO2 content in the sample can be determined.
